Rosaangelica is a unique and beautiful name of Spanish origin. It is composed of two elements: "Rosa," which means "rose" in Spanish, and "Angelica," which is derived from the Latin word "angelus," meaning "angel." Therefore, Rosaangelica translates to "Rose Angelic."

The name Rosaangelica has seen a limited amount of use in the United States over the past couple of years, with only five babies being named Rosaangelica each year from 1993 to 1994. This gives us a total of ten births across those two years for this unique name.
